MD drop head Galvanized and partly powder-coated. A safety latch prevents disengagement. The MD drop head permits lowering the formwork by approx. 19 cm so that it can be removed and reused to form the next cycle (early stripping); only props with drop heads remain in position to support the slab until the final setting of the concrete. 16 29-301-50... MEP prop with SAS Combination of steel inner tube and aluminium outer tube with T groove to attach reinforcing frames. The SAS quick lowering system allows the stress in the prop to be released with one strike of a hammer. After stripping the prop automatically resets and locks in the original position. According to the European Standard EN 65 the load capacity is as follows when used as a single prop: MEP 300 with SAS 40 kn at any extension; MEP 450 with SAS 20 kn at any assembly position (or 30 kn when the inner tube is at the bottom).
